Speaker of Rajasthan Legislative Assembly, Dr. C.P. Joshi has issued a notice for violation of the whip to all the MLAs who have been removed from the cabinet.


Government Chief Whip Mahesh Joshi filed a petition before the Speaker, Dr. Joshi, in this matter. Dr. Joshi has issued notice to 19 MLAs for violating the Whip.

It is believed that the Congress Party has taken this action as a strategy to get the rebel MLAs in its favor, so that its MLA can return.

Membership of MLAs can be done in case of violation of whip but there are many legal tricks in it. Rebel MLAs can approach the court on the issue of whip not being implemented due to any proceedings being held outside the house.

Meanwhile, senior Congress leaders are making further strategies by talking to the party MLAs staying in a hotel. Chief Minister Ashok Gehlot also held talks with these MLAs late at night. Legislators supporting Mr. Pilot have also been accommodated in a hotel outside the state.
